如何在Eloquent中获取数据?

时间:2014-06-02 07:18:56

标签: laravel eloquent

是否可以使用Eloquent执行PDOStatement::fetchAll之类的操作?我需要从db中获取3个字段,但是当我使用get时,它返回带有其他数据的对象,我需要循环它以获取我的数据。

1 个答案:

答案 0 :(得分:2)

您可以将toArray()select()get()

一起使用
$data = Model::where(YOUR_WHERE_CLAUSE)->select('post_id', 'name', 'description)->get()->toArray();

它将返回一个包含所需数据的关联数组。 但是你仍然需要遍历行来获取查询返回的每一行的数据。